Job Title and Summary: As a graphic designer, you will be part of the Visual Creative Services team where you will turn ideas, causes and campaigns into designs that move people to act. You will collaborate closely with team members to produce compelling, impactful, high-quality visual assets for the various departments within the Soi Dog Foundation that carry our mission into the world.

  1. Key Responsibilities: Prepares work to be accomplished by gathering project briefs, relevant information and design materials.
  2. Conceptualize and execute high-quality designs for external communications.
  3. Collaborates cross-functionally with team members and various departments within the organisation to fulfil ongoing asset requests.
  4. Work closely with other creatives on artistic direction, brainstorming and concepts.
  5. Translate strategic goals into visual concepts that communicate a clear, compelling message.
  6. Determine ideal design elements, by including colour theory, image selection and grid layouts.
  7. Ensure brand consistency across all digital and print assets.
  8. Present design concepts to senior staff and key stakeholders with confidence and clarity.
  9. Refines and polishes designs based on collaborative feedback from seniors, managers and team members to ensure the best result.
  10. Reviewing designs for formatting, typos and technical accuracy before printing or publishing.
  11. Organises daily priorities effectively to keep the projects moving forward smoothly.

Department and Supervisor: This position reports to the Visual Creative Services Manager under the supervision of the Senior Graphic Designer.

  1. Skills and Qualifications: Advanced experience in Adobe Creative Cloud. (Photoshop, InDesign and Illustrator especially)

  2. Experience with preparing both digital platforms (web, social) and physical print production.

  3. Minimum of 1 to 2 years of professional graphic design experience.

  4. The ability to clearly communicate the reasoning behind design choices.

  5. Comfortable sharing ideas and an open attitude toward feedback and design adjustments.

  6. A genuine passion for animal welfare and a strong commitment to supporting the mission of a not-for-profit organisation.

  7. Good attention to details

  8. Higher level of English writing and speaking.

  9. Able to communicate with all organisational departments and the team members.

  10. Desirable Skills and Experience:Experience with digital product design, UI/UX or wireframing tools like Figma or Sketch

  11. Familiarity with modern AI tools for creative brainstorming and asset generation.

Location: Soi Dog Foundation, Maikhao, Phuket Thailand

  • Benefits: Five-day work a week, 40 hours per week with two days off. Employee may start and finish work different times depending on their duties as directed by their manager.
  • 19 annual holidays (including Thai National Holidays 13 days) rising to 25 days with year of service
  • Annual Salary Adjustment
  • Annual Service bonus
  • Social Security
  • Provident Fund
  • Uniform
